What Is Thymosin Alpha-1?

Thymosin Alpha-1 (Tα1) is a synthetic peptide consisting of 28 amino acids.

It was originally isolated as a peptide fragment associated with thymosin preparations and subsequently characterized and synthesized for research purposes. Thymosin Alpha-1 has attracted significant scientific interest because of its involvement in research surrounding immune-system signaling and cellular responses.

Unlike Thymalin, which is generally discussed as a broader thymic peptide preparation, Thymosin Alpha-1 refers to a specific 28-amino-acid peptide.

The commonly reported amino-acid sequence for Thymosin Alpha-1 is:

Ac-Ser-Asp-Ala-Ala-Val-Asp-Thr-Ser-Ser-Glu-Ile-Thr-Thr-Lys-Asp-Leu-Lys-Glu-Lys-Lys-Glu-Val-Val-Glu-Glu-Ala-Asn

Thymosin Alpha-1 is an N-terminally acetylated peptide, which is an important characteristic when researchers are evaluating its molecular identity and analytical properties.

Thymosin Alpha-1 and Innate Immune Signaling

Another important research area is innate immune signaling.

Experimental research has investigated relationships between Thymosin Alpha-1 and pathways involving Toll-like receptors (TLRs) and downstream signaling molecules.

Toll-like receptors are pattern-recognition receptors that help cells recognize molecular structures associated with pathogens and cellular damage.
